On Goodness


GOODNESS IS NOT TIED TO GREATNESS, BUT GREATNESS TO GOODNESS.”      Greek proverb

11 If you are sensible, you will control your temper. When someone wrongs you, it is a great virtue to ignore it.
Proverbs xviii v. 11
7 Can you discover the limits and bounds of the greatness and power of God? 8 The sky is no limit for God, but it lies beyond your reach. God knows the world of the dead, but you do not know it. 9 God’s greatness is broader than the earth, wider than the sea. 10 If God arrests you and brings you to trial, who is there to stop him?
Book of Job, xi.7-10
